Output 670af672caeca19768a205f55515a232bb6441c09d68af0a3c1eaa5fb0bf19c9:5

value
173008
script pubkey
OP_0 OP_PUSHBYTES_20 dfacf58df893a8f4b9563744a68d34d4a973932e
address
bc1qm7k0tr0cjw50fw2kxaz2drf56j5h8yewkmg4yy
transaction
670af672caeca19768a205f55515a232bb6441c09d68af0a3c1eaa5fb0bf19c9
spent
true